Groove Coverage is a Dance and Pop band from Ingolstadt, Germany. It was formed in the summer of 2001. The Groove Coverage project consists of Axel Konrad and DJ Novus. Kate Ryan (born Katrien Verbeeck on July 22, 1980) is a Belgian World Music Award winner. Vengaboys are a eurodance band that came to prominence in 1997. AnnaGrace was a Belgian trance music project fronted by Belgian singer Annemie Coenen and produced by Belgian DJ/producer Peter Luts.
